History
George Edwin Bond. Born 13 November 1913 in Wondai, Queensland. Attended high school in Bundaberg. Worked in various tradesman positions. Enlisted in the RAAF in 1942 and served in Australia and Papua New Guinea. On return from war he was involved in the manufacture and erection of thousands of headstones for war cemeteries. Rejoined the RAAF in 1952 during the Korean War. Discharged in 1966. Worked as a caretaker at Newstead House and then the University of Queensland Library. Retired in 1977. Lifelong railway enthusiast and passionate researcher of Queensland history, particularly genealogy and monumental masonry. Member of the Australian Railway Historical Society and at one time served as Councillor of the Queensland Division of the ARHS. Also a member of the Light Railway Research Society of Australia Inc. (LRRSA). Moved to the Gold Coast in 1986. Died on 6 June 2011 on the Gold Coast.
